We have created a new opportunity for an experienced Transport Co-ordinator to join our business ensuring that all operational and compliance heavy goods transport related duties and obligations are achieved within the required timescales. Working closely with the Transport Manager, this would ideally suit an individual who has proven working administration experience of Transport operations and compliance. This will be a busy and challenging role providing great job satisfaction.
Main Objectives:
- Assist with the management of the HGV fleet and PMI schedules.
- Ensure all MOT’s are organised and vehicle defects are reported.
- Complete driver licence checks, analyse tacho recordings, collate data on infringements, manage driver hours and rest periods.
- Allocate drivers, vehicles and trailers to jobs.
- Schedule deliveries and collections.
- Act as the first point of contact for drivers and deputise in the Transport Manager’s absence.
